About CPOMS

CPOMS, a Raptor Technologies company, is the market leader in safeguarding, pastoral, and wellbeing solutions for UK educational institutions and beyond. Through our innovative software, we’ve enabled organisations to transform modern day safeguarding practices to help ensure the wellbeing of young people and vulnerable adults. Trusted by over 20,000 customers, ranging from schools, early years settings, sports clubs, youth activities and charities, CPOMS is committed to enhancing child protection and wellbeing practices.

Main Purpose

You will work closely with our Sales Team to generate leads and build a strong pipeline to help drive growth in the UK.

Responsible For

  • Acting as the first point of contact for new prospects and current clients as they move through the sales funnel.
  • Working directly with marketing to discover opportunities from leads and set appointments from those leads.
  • Providing a high volume of outbound calling and emailing to prospective clients.
  • Managing the sales enquiries/orders and actioning all correspondence accordingly.
  • Using strong selling and influencing skills to set up qualified appointments.
  • Understanding CPOMS solutions enough to provide a high-level introduction.
  • Updating and maintaining customer database using Salesforce.
  • Preparing and delivering weekly and monthly updates to the Sales Managers.
  • Contributing to monthly PowerPoint presentations for team meetings.
  • Delivering the highest levels of customer satisfaction both internally and externally.
  • Contributing fairly to all departmental goals.
